ingredients
- 1 cup warm water
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 1 tablespoon dry yeast
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 2 3⁄4 cups whole wheat flour (approx)
directions
- Stir the butter into the warm water until it melts (this should take about 1 minute at the most).
- Stir the yeast and salt in the water/butter mixture until dissolves; then allow the yeast to bloom (10 minutes).
- Stir in honey.
- Gradually work in enough flour to make a soft, workable dough.
- Turn out on a floured board and knead until elastic and smooth.
- Let rise until doubled in bulk (30 minutes).
- Preheat oven to 500°F.
- Turn out on a floured board and knead briefly.
- Form into 12 balls.
- Roll each ball out to 1/4-inch thick, and let rise for 15 minutes.
- Turn over onto a greased baking sheet and bake for 10 minutes (watch closely so they don't brown too much).
